Key Responsibilities as an Alloy Wheel Technician:
  • Repair and refurbish alloy wheels to manufacturer standards.
  • Carry out wheel preparation, sanding, filling and refinishing work as required.
  • Undertake cosmetic repairs to damaged alloy wheels.
  • Apply paint and lacquer finishes to a high standard.
  • Ensure all work is completed within agreed timescales.
  • Maintain exceptional attention to detail and quality standards.
  • Work effectively within a busy bodyshop team environment.
  • Adhere to all health and safety procedures.
